Python语言值不值得学习?有没有什么好的规划?Python在软件质量控制、提升开发效率、可移植性、组件集成、丰富库支持等各个方面均处于先进地位。同样学习编程语言,当然要选择学习业内目前先进、热门、将来应用广泛、有前途和前景的编程语言。下面一同来看看吧。接下来,小编想告诉你几个判断方法:1、想清楚:为啥要学python学习是需要动力的,动力来自于内在的渴望,比如有的同学是要转行,原来是学其他语言
游戏代码也写了几年, 有时候在想如果现在给刚入行的自己一点建议也许能有一点帮助。所以这篇日志主要是分享一下自己对于游戏编程入门的一些想法。这篇文章由爱发电支持写作, 如果你喜欢我做的事情,可以考虑在那里支持我。语言的选择在一开始更多是推荐从高级语言入门,比如 Java、C#、lua、python,javascript。在这个时期可以配合一些游戏引擎来学习,如果你是因为喜欢游戏才学习编程的可能不
目录SSM、SpringBootSpring Boot1、怎么理解Spring Boot中的“约定大于配置”?2、SpringBoot的优势?3、SpringBoot项目启动流程4、SpringApplication中的静态方法run方法内部做了什么?5、Spring Boot的自动配置6、SpringBoot自动装配过程7、注解Spring1、Spring的核心2、对Spring容器的理解3
环境准备1)基础软件安装MySQL (5.5+) 必选,对应客户端可以选装, Linux服务上若安装mysql的客户端可以通过部署脚本快速初始化数据库JDK (1.8.0_xxx) 必选Maven (3.6.1+) 必选DataX 必选Python (2.x) (支持Python3需要修改替换datax/bin下面的三个python文件,替换文件在doc/datax-web/datax-pytho
Python 为开发者提供了许多便利,其中最大的便利之一是其几乎无忧的内存管理。开发者无需手动为 Python 中的对象和数据结构分配、跟踪和释放内存。运行时会为你完成所有这些工作,因此你可以专注于解决实际问题,而不是争论机器级细节。尽管如此,即使是经验不多的 Python 用户,了解 Python 的垃圾收集和内存管理是如何工作的也是有好处的。了解这些机制将帮助你避免更复杂的项目可能出现的性能问
如果你是一个初学者,或者你以前接触过其他的编程语言,你可能不知道,在开始学习python的时候都会遇到一个比
原创 2022-10-27 06:14:41
195阅读
# 启动 Vue 项目并选择合适的 Python 版本 在开始使用 Vue.js 进行开发时,您可能会需要与后端 Python 代码进行交互。选择合适的 Python 版本(Python 2 还是 Python 3)对于项目的成功至关重要。本文将详细介绍如何配置并启动 Vue 项目,同时确保 Python 环境的正确选择。 ## 流程步骤 | 步骤 | 描述 | |------|------
原创 10月前
93阅读
一、版本对比首先要说的是,Python的版本,目前主要分为两大类:Python 2.x的版本的,被称为Python2:是目前用的最广泛的,比如Python 2.7.3。Python 3.x的版本的,被称为Python3:是最新的版本的,比如Python 3.1。长远来看,也算是以后的趋势。【Python2Python3之间的区别】1.从Python2Python3,很多基本的函数接口变了,甚至
转载 2023-08-30 22:59:03
79阅读
作为一名程序员,我来谈谈我的看法。首先必须明确一点,Java和Python双方都有各自适合和发展的领域,所以别人常问我学习什么语言好,或者让我在两种语言进行比较好坏,编程语言只有适不适合,不存在好坏,你想从事什么工作就去学习什么语言。下面我来分析这两种语言的一些应用场景和特性。Java语言首先本人就是学习Java的。Java语言是一种面相对象编程语言,他最大的特点就是可以实现跨平台编程,不受平台限
原创 2021-03-03 10:30:28
234阅读
1. 性能:python3.0运行pystone benchmark 的速度比python2.5慢30%。Guido认为python3.0有极大的优化空间,在字符串和整形操作上可以取得很好的优化结果。 python3.1性能比python2.5慢15%,还有很大的提升空间。 2. 编码:python3源码文件默认使用utf-8编码 3. 语法:   1) 去
转载 2023-05-26 16:56:50
235阅读
如果你是一个初学者,或者你以前接触过其他的编程语言,你可能不知道,在开始学习python的时候都会遇到一个比较让人很头疼的问题:版本问题!!是学习python2 还是学习 python3 ?这是非常让人纠结的!搜索一下便会发现python3python2 是不兼容的,而且差异比较大,到底学习哪个版本呢?下面就来为大家分析一下: 其实python是linux上最常用的软件之一,但是l
原创 2017-11-09 17:21:13
1903阅读
在现代开发环境中,Python 是一种广泛使用的编程语言。然而,由于 Python 2Python 3 之间的差异,开发者在使用 Bash 命令行界面时常常会面临“bash运行的是python3还是python2”的问题。这一问题的解决不仅关乎开发效率,还可能影响到应用程序的兼容性和性能。本文将详细介绍如何识别及解决这一问题,以帮助开发者有效过渡到合适的 Python 版本。 ## 版本对
原创 7月前
34阅读
## RF框架再Python2还是Python3好呢 Robot Framework(RF)是一种基于关键字的自动化测试框架,广泛应用于接受测试驱动开发(ATDD)和验收测试。随着技术的发展,Python 2于2020年1月1日正式停止支持,而Python 3已成为主流选择。因此,越来越多的用户开始思考在使用Robot Framework时应该选择Python 2还是Python 3。 ###
原创 2024-10-06 05:19:16
28阅读
vue开发搭建(npm安装 + vue脚手架安装) 一、概念 1、npm: Nodejs下的包管理器。2、webpack: 它主要的用途是通过CommonJS的语法,把所有浏览器端需要发布的静态资源,做相应的准备,比如资源的合并和打包。3、vue-cli: 用户生成Vue工程模板。(帮你快速开始一个vue的项目,也就是给你一套vue的结构,包含基础的依赖库,只需要 npm install就可以安装
# 如何确定“pywin32”是用于Python 2还是Python 3 在开发过程中,很多开发者会为了方便使用一些库来提升开发效率,`pywin32`就是这样一个数据接口库。`pywin32`是一个为Windows平台提供Python自动化的库,不同的Python版本会有不同的`pywin32`安装方式和包。因此,了解你所使用的Python版本非常重要。 本文将帮助你确定`pywin32`是
原创 10月前
159阅读
在使用 pytest 进行测试时,选择合适的 Python 版本(Python 2Python 3)是一个重要的决策。随着 Python 2 的官方支持结束,许多开发者及团队正逐步向 Python 3 迁移,这引发了一系列的问题和挑战。本文将详细阐述如何选择使用 pytest 的 Python 版本,包括可能出现的错误及解决方案。 ## 问题背景 在现代软件开发中,测试是至关重要的一步。
# 学习Python版本指导 在学Python之前,选择合适的版本非常重要。随着Python3的发布,许多新特性和改进得到了支持。而Python2在2020年停止了官方支持。因此,本文将帮助你了解如何确定并安装合适的Python版本。 接下来,我们会详细阐述整个流程,并提供相应的代码示例和详细注释。 ## 整体流程 以下是学习和安装Python的流程: | 步骤 | 描述 | |---
原创 2024-10-17 11:10:18
50阅读
看到这个题目大家可能猜到了我接下来要讲些什么,呵呵,对了,那就是列出这两个不同版本间的却别!搜索一下大家就会知道,python有两个主要的版本,python2python3 ,但是python又不同于其他语言,向下兼容,python3是不向下兼容的,但是绝大多数组件和扩展都是基于python2的,下面就来总结一下python2python3的区别。 1.性能 Py3.0运行 pystone
不得不佩服 Spring Boot 的生态如此强大,今天我给大家推荐几款 Gitee 上优秀的后台开源版本的管理系统,小伙伴们再也不用从头到尾撸一个项目了,简直就是接私活,挣钱的利器啊。SmartAdmin我们开源一套漂亮的代码和一套整洁的代码规范,让大家在这浮躁的代码世界里感受到一股把代码写好的清流!同时又让开发者节省大量的时间,减少加班,快乐工作,热爱生活。SmartAdmin 让你从认识到忘
简介由于我要看到书和视频教程都是使用Python2.x来编写的,而这里准备使用的Python是3.6的版本,所以我觉得有必要在此之前了解这两个版本的不同之处。由于这也是面试经常被问到的问题,所以这里准备了两个方面: (1)系统分析两者的不同。 (2)面试时候的回答内容。不同之处(1)系统分析两者的不同: Python2.x与3.x版本区别-菜鸟教程 Python2.x与3.x版本区别在这里
转载 2023-12-14 11:24:41
43阅读
  • 1
  • 2
  • 3
  • 4
  • 5